7 Excel Functions & Formulas for Advanced Data Visualization

7 Excel Functions & Formulas for Advanced Data Visualization

Introduction to Excel for Data Visualization

Microsoft Excel is no longer just a data-entry tool — it’s a powerhouse for data analysis, automation, and visualization. With the right formulas, you can turn boring spreadsheets into living dashboards that tell compelling data stories.

If you’ve already mastered the advanced Excel basics, you’re ready to take your skills up a notch. In this guide, we’ll explore the top 7 Excel functions and formulas for advanced data visualization — the same tools professionals use to build interactive dashboards, predictive charts, and real-time performance trackers.


Why Excel Still Dominates Data Visualization

Even with Power BI and Tableau in the market, Excel remains the most flexible visualization platform for small businesses and analysts. Why? Because Excel gives you total formula-driven control — you decide what the chart shows, how it updates, and how it reacts to user input.

Using features like Excel dashboards and conditional formatting, you can visually display trends, KPIs, and forecasts in real time.


The Power of Excel Functions and Formulas

Excel functions are like the “code” behind your visuals. They make charts smart, responsive, and meaningful. When you blend formulas with visuals, you unlock a new world of data storytelling.

So, let’s dive into the 7 must-know Excel functions for anyone serious about advanced visualization.

7 Excel Functions & Formulas for Advanced Data Visualization

1. The POWER Function: Calculating Dynamic Growth in Charts

Understanding the POWER Function

The POWER() function helps you calculate exponential or compound growth — a foundation for modeling trends, sales increases, or population projections.

Syntax:
=POWER(number, power)

Learn more about how Excel handles math operations in Excel formulas.

Practical Example: Exponential Growth Visualization

If your company grows 5% each month, you can model that growth visually with:

=POWER(1.05,MonthNumber)

Plot the output on a line chart to create a smooth exponential curve showing your data’s growth trajectory.

How to Use POWER in Dashboards

In financial modeling or forecasting dashboards, use POWER to visualize compound interest, ROI, or recurring revenue trends dynamically.


2. The INDEX-MATCH Combo: Building Interactive Visual Reports

Why INDEX-MATCH Beats VLOOKUP

If you’re still using VLOOKUP, it’s time to upgrade. The INDEX-MATCH combo is faster, more flexible, and doesn’t break when columns move.

Formula:

=INDEX(ReturnRange, MATCH(LookupValue, LookupRange, 0))

It’s one of the best techniques covered in data analysis & reporting.

Example: Data-Driven Dropdown Charts

Imagine having a dropdown that allows users to select a product, and your chart updates instantly. INDEX-MATCH makes this possible by dynamically fetching the correct data series.

Tips for Using INDEX-MATCH in Visual Dashboards

  • Use named ranges for clarity.
  • Pair it with OFFSET for flexible visual references.
  • Combine with Excel automation to make updates seamless.

3. The OFFSET Function: Dynamic Chart Ranges

OFFSET Explained Simply

The OFFSET() function returns a range that shifts relative to a reference cell.

Syntax:
=OFFSET(reference, rows, cols, [height], [width])

This is essential when creating auto-updating charts that grow with your data.

Example: Creating an Auto-Updating Chart

=OFFSET(Sheet1!$A$2,0,0,COUNTA(Sheet1!$A:$A)-1)

Once you set this as your chart’s data source, Excel automatically expands the range as new entries are added.
Learn more about handling such tasks in Excel productivity and automation.

How OFFSET Enhances Interactivity

OFFSET pairs beautifully with INDEX or MATCH to create dynamic visual dashboards that refresh automatically—no manual updates needed.


4. The IF and Conditional Formatting Combo

Visual Alerts Through IF Functions

The IF() function allows logical visualizations — ideal for highlighting thresholds, KPIs, and alerts.
Syntax:
=IF(condition, value_if_true, value_if_false)

Example: Highlighting KPIs in Dashboards

=IF(Sales>Target,"Above","Below")

Then, use Excel conditional formatting to color “Above” in green and “Below” in red.

Conditional Formatting with IF Logic

This combo forms the visual heartbeat of your dashboards — providing instant, color-coded feedback without needing extra charts.


5. The AGGREGATE Function: Smarter Data Summarization

Why AGGREGATE Beats SUM and AVERAGE

Unlike SUM or AVERAGE, AGGREGATE() can ignore hidden rows, filtered data, and even errors. Perfect for real-time Excel dashboards that summarize only visible or valid data.

Syntax:
=AGGREGATE(function_num, options, array, [k])

Example: Filtering Out Errors in Visual Reports

When your data includes errors like #DIV/0!, AGGREGATE can skip those gracefully, ensuring charts display clean summaries.

Using AGGREGATE in Dynamic Tables

Use AGGREGATE in combination with slicers and filters for live, interactive summaries. Learn more techniques like this in data cleaning & transformation.


6. The TEXT Function: Polishing Data Labels for Visual Impact

How TEXT Makes Charts Easier to Read

TEXT() converts raw numbers into formatted text — a lifesaver for clear chart labels and dynamic headers.

Syntax:
=TEXT(value, format_text)

Example: Formatting Chart Titles Dynamically

="Revenue for "&TEXT(TODAY(),"mmmm yyyy")

Your chart now auto-updates its title every month — no manual edits required.

Pairing TEXT with CONCAT or “&”

Combine TEXT with CONCAT or & to create smart labels like:

=TEXT(Sales,"$#,##0")&" achieved in "&TEXT(TODAY(),"mmmm")

Check out more creative data presentation ideas under Excel design & visuals.


7. The FORECAST Function: Predictive Data Visualization

Using FORECAST for Trend Analysis

FORECAST() predicts future values based on existing data — essential for predictive analytics.
Syntax:
=FORECAST(x, known_y’s, known_x’s)

Example: Visualizing Sales Forecasts

Plot your past sales data and apply FORECAST to project future performance. Then display it with Excel charts for a clear visual forecast.

Building Predictive Dashboards

You can also use Excel forecasting techniques to blend actual and projected data, color-coding differences for better decision-making.


Bonus: Combining Multiple Functions for Dynamic Dashboards

Power of Nested Formulas in Visual Analytics

The real magic happens when you combine formulas. For instance:

=IF(FORECAST(CurrentMonth,DataY,DataX)>Target,"On Track","Behind")

Now your dashboard can automatically indicate if performance is trending positively or negatively.

Example: Live KPI Tracking Dashboard

By merging IF, FORECAST, and TEXT, you can create live dashboards that monitor sales, marketing reach, or expenses. Explore similar builds in Excel project management.


Best Practices for Excel Data Visualization

Keep It Simple and Consistent

Avoid cluttered visuals. Stick to 2–3 chart colors, clear fonts, and consistent label placement.

Use Named Ranges for Cleaner Formulas

Named ranges like SalesData make formulas more readable than $A$2:$A$100.

Always Validate Data Before Visualizing

Start by performing a quick Excel data cleanup to eliminate duplicates or errors. Clean data = accurate visuals.


Common Mistakes to Avoid in Excel Visualization

Overusing Complex Formulas

Complexity doesn’t equal clarity. Use simplicity to make visuals more understandable.

Ignoring Data Cleaning

Never visualize raw data without transformation. Visit data cleaning & transformation to learn proper steps.

Forgetting User Interaction

Dashboards should respond to users — think slicers, checkboxes, or interactive charts linked to Excel automation.


Conclusion

By mastering these 7 Excel functions — POWER, INDEX-MATCH, OFFSET, IF, AGGREGATE, TEXT, and FORECAST — you can elevate your Excel dashboards from static charts to dynamic data experiences.

Excel is not just a tool; it’s a complete data visualization platform capable of storytelling, forecasting, and automation.

Next time you build a dashboard, think beyond cells — think insights.


FAQs

1. What’s the best Excel function for dynamic dashboards?
Use OFFSET with INDEX to make your charts expand automatically as data grows.

2. Can Excel forecast future trends visually?
Yes — the FORECAST() function, combined with Excel trend analysis, does it brilliantly.

3. How can I highlight KPIs automatically?
Combine IF logic with conditional formatting for automatic performance indicators.

4. What makes INDEX-MATCH better than VLOOKUP for charts?
It’s more flexible, accurate, and perfect for Excel data reformatting.

5. Can I combine formulas to create interactive visuals?
Absolutely — nesting formulas like IF(FORECAST()) adds interactivity and adaptability.

6. How do I make charts auto-update with new data?
Use OFFSET with dynamic ranges or explore Excel automation techniques.

7. Is Excel good for professional dashboards?
Yes! With formulas, macros, and smart visuals, Excel rivals premium BI tools for business models and reporting.

Leave a Reply

Your email address will not be published. Required fields are marked *